Youth Mobilization Initiative Launched in Fada N’Gourma to Support Progressive Revolution

Fada n'gourma: The Secretary General of the Gourma Province, Botetessan Bonou, representing the High Commissioner, presided over the official launch of the "Revolutionary Youth on the March" (JeRM) initiative in Fada N'Gourma. This initiative aims to further mobilize young people around the ideals of the Popular Progressive Revolution (RPP).

According to Burkina Information Agency, the JeRM initiative was initiated by the Ministry of Sports, Youth, and Employment and was launched nationally by the Prime Minister before being implemented across Burkina Faso's 47 provinces. The initiative is intended to empower young people to take ownership of the progressive popular revolution led by President Ibrahim Traore. Botetessan Bonou emphasized the importance of involving youth in this movement, highlighting the strong turnout of youth organizations at the ceremony.

The provincial director of Sports, Youth and Employment of Gourma, Boubacar Ouedraogo, elaborated on the activities under JeRM, aimed at supporting the ideals of the Popular Progressive Revolution. He called on Burkinabe youth to embody revolutionary ideals in their daily actions and decisions as a means of national engagement.

Moumouni Yougbare, spokesperson for a citizen watchdog group in the Goulmou region, criticized certain local elements he claimed are working to destabilize Burkina Faso and other member countries of the Alliance of Sahel States (AES) for the benefit of foreign powers. He urged the youth of Gourma to support Captain Ibrahim Traore's mission to liberate Burkina Faso from imperialism.

The launch event also featured a fun run and an aerobics session to promote cohesion, discipline, and civic engagement among young people. The ceremony was attended by administrative officials, youth organizations, and civil society actors from the Gourma province.
